Marketing Designer
Chairish Incorporated
(San Francisco, California)Chairish.com makes it fun and easy for design lovers to buy and sell vintage furniture, decor, jewelry and accessories to one another. Our shop exclusively features curator-approved treasures in a full-service and trustworthy environment.
Buy. Sell. Adore.
We are looking for a talented Marketing Designer with a passion for digital media, graphic design, photography, typography, and a love of vintage home decor. The Marketing Designer will help create beautiful, integrated, and effective designs for the Chairish brand. This role will work with the Creative Director to concept, execute, and produce a wide range of digital and print projects. The Marketing Designer will support the digital creative team with graphic production, documentation, file management, and photo archiving. This is a full time position that can be based either in San Francisco or Los Angeles.
- Create visual assets for digital channels: Web home pages, landing pages, email marketing, blog posts, social media assets, digital ads, etc
- Design and oversee production of printed marketing projects
- Apply industry best practices and established brand style guides to assignments
- Participate in project brainstorming and concept development
- Translate business and marketing objectives into designs that are clear, compelling, and visually engaging
- Partner with engineering and product teams to maintain high visual standards
- Initiate concepts and work independently and/or with design leads
- Present multiple solutions per project
- Manage timing and deliverables for project work
- Must be able to handle a number of projects simultaneously
- Present creative to business partners
- Work closely with product team during implementation
- Take project from inception through production
- BFA in Graphic or Communication Design, and a minimum of 2 years work experience
-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ite, expert knowledge of Photoshop
- Knowledge of digital optimization across screen sizes and devices
- Familiarity with CSS, HTML and web typography (Google Fonts, Typekit etc.)
- Experience designing with responsive grids for mobile, tablet and desktop
- Eye for detail and passion for typography
- Ability to prioritize, multi-task, and meet deadlines in a fast-paced startup environment
- Highly organized with an ability to self-direct and work independently
- Positive working attitude, strong work ethic, and team-player mentality
- Ability to communicate effectively with a broad spectrum of colleagues
- Knowledge of user experience design and technology trends
- Solid presentation skills
- Prior experience with a home décor, fashion, or beauty brand preferred
- Illustration and photography skills preferred
